4. Thermal Energy Storage Containers. Thermal energy storage containers store energy by heating or cooling a medium and then releasing the energy as heat or cold when needed. These systems are particularly valuable for balancing supply and demand in heating and cooling systems or integrating with renewable energy systems like solar power.

The containers are standard size containers of 12m long x2.5m wide x2.7m high. The addition of the HVAC systems may protrude outside the containers making them a bit longer or higher

Let’s dive in! What are containerized BESS? Containerized Battery Energy Storage Systems (BESS) are essentially large batteries housed within storage containers. These systems are designed to store energy from renewable sources or the grid and release it when required. This setup offers a modular and scalable solution to energy storage.
These energy storage containers often lower capital costs and operational expenses, making them a viable economic alternative to traditional energy solutions. The modular nature of containerized systems often results in lower installation and maintenance costs compared to traditional setups.
